Yesterday, housing developers, business leaders, residents, and legislators gathered at the Minnesota State Capitol to celebrate an innovative, award-winning initiative that expands access to affordable housing across Minnesota. The event also highlighted strong support for extending the legislation that sustains this proven, high-demand program.
The State Housing Tax Credit (SHTC) and Contribution Fund is a powerful, proven community-driven tool to address our state’s housing challenges. Individuals and businesses across our state have contributed more than $42 million to support 107 housing projects in urban, suburban and rural communities statewide, helping projects move forward faster and creating real impact for Minnesotans.
The amazing speakers today spoke to the program’s strong bipartisan support, its widespread adoption across Minnesota communities, and how it has activated both individuals and businesses to invest in housing and housing infrastructure.
Legislators also shared how their proposals (HF3902/SF4044) will strengthen the program, improve its effectiveness, and address the upcoming sunset (2028) to ensure the SHTC continues connecting private investment with public good.
